Output 526949194e865f657a57d59c82c16a59eb0f70a0b4345c87b9c4339f2c9e867d:1

value
1113447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d577d03725eb5d760fae03afaad39c4fc3db87e9 OP_EQUAL
address
3M9jPBRbpiSP7wE2L6TsFSXQUQ8Cc3ET7W
transaction
526949194e865f657a57d59c82c16a59eb0f70a0b4345c87b9c4339f2c9e867d
spent
true